The ingredients needed to make Simply Tiramisu:
  1. Make ready 2 eggs (yolk only)
  2. Take Salt (2-3 teaspoons)
  3. Prepare Heavy Cream (200ml)
  4. Make ready Sugar (3-4 spoons)
  5. Take Biszkopty (French cookies)
  6. Take 1 cup coffee
  7. Get Chocolate powder

Instructions to make Simply Tiramisu:
  1. Put the egg yolk in the glass bowl
  2. Add sugar to the glass bowl
  3. Put the glass bowl in the pot filled with water (350ml)
  4. Mix the egg yolk and sugar inside the glass bowl using whisker
  5. After the sugar mixed with the egg yolk, and the mixture is a bit compact, wait until it gets cold (not hot anymore)
  6. Put the heavy cream in another bowl
  7. Add salt into the bowl of heavy cream
  8. Mix heavy cream and the salt using whisker
  9. Mix until the heavy cream is compacted
  10. Add the egg and sugar mixture into heavy cream bowl
  11. Mix the mixture until it gets compacted
  12. Get ready for the biszkopty and the coffee
  13. Pour hot water into coffee powder, stir like when you want to make a cup of coffee
  14. Put the biszkopty into the coffee, let the cookie absorb the coffee
  15. Prepare the tiramisu bowl (rectangle shape)
  16. Pour the mixture into the bowl as a base
  17. Put one per one biszkopty into the bowl, arrange them in a proper row
  18. Pour the mixture above the biszkopty
  19. Put the biszkopty above the mixture for the second layer and close the layer with another pour of mixture
  20. Put the tiramisu to the refrigerator at least 6-7 hours until it gets cold and hard enough
  21. After 6-7 hours, pour the chocolate powder above the cake.
